Suzanne's Story

Life This picture is for our missionary prayer card as we and the young family with us travel to Honduras. The picture includes Don and me, our two daughters, Amanda and Amy Grace, but not our sons, who will both be at Grove City College. After Westminster graduation, I taught school for a couple of years in Front Royal, VA. Returning to Shippensburg University for graduate school, I completed my MEd in counseling in 1983, then married Don Rumbaugh that summer. Don and I were in Hershey, PA for his final year of medical school, then it was off to the Air Force life for 9 years. We lived on Andrews AFB, where he did his 3 years of Family Practice residency. I taught and developed an elementary counseling program for the Grace Brethren Christian Schools nearby. We had Luke in March of '86 and Eric in July of '87. A mnoth later we were flying to Woonstrect AFB in the Netherlands. We served three wonderful years overseas, first in the ND, then in Germany, and got to visit such interesting places that made history come alive. We had great fellowship and growth, too, through the Officers Christian Fellowship and Precepts Ministries Bible Studies. Amanda was born in the ND in February of '90. We moved back to Spokane, WA to Fairchild AFB later that fall. During our year+ there we had wonderful experiences and friends, and Don was deployed during Desert Storm for awhile. safely, we cherished dear friendships and a vibrant Christian community. We were sad to say good-bye, but drove across the country with our three children in a little Toyota in December of 1991. We moved into our current home in Pompton Plains, NJ the day after Christmas and began our own Family Practice. I was office manager, janitor, whatever. We lost a baby halfway through my pregnancy just 2 months after arriving in NJ, but God's grace and peace sustained us through that crisis. A couple of years later, in September of 1994, He would bless us with our second daughter, Amy Grace - short for Amazing Grace. I have homeschooled our children since Germany, and involvement in the homeschooling community has been rewarding and a major investment of time and talents. We have been involved over the years with short-to-mid-term missions projects, mostly in Jamaica and Honduras. We all lived in HN for 7 months in 2002. Don still practices medicine part-time, and serves as an ordained C&MA Pastor of Family Life at Cornerstone Chapel. Currently our sons are a sophomore at Grove City College and a Sr. at the local high school - a first, and we anticipate moving to Honduras with the girls next fall to do full-time ministry work at a missions hospital. Life is rich and full. We are grateful for the Lord's blessings and purpose in our lives. I pray that you, too, know His grace. Ephesians 2:8-10. Bye!
